  • Abstract
    Application of MMW/THz electron spin resonance for high magnetic field spin science will be presented. A MMW/THz electron spin resonance(ESR) is one of the most important spin probes in condensed matters. The applications to non-linear excitation in low dimensional magnetic systems, nano-magnetic molecules and hard magnetic material will be discussed. Furthermore, the activities in THz electron spin resonance in the priority area project "high magnetic spin science in 100 T" will be presented.
